    March 8, 2024 - Open in the bottle for about three hours. Nose is quite poopy at first but eventually that blows off to reveal…not much. A little smoke, some mushrooms, generally very earthy. Palate is nice, initially full with some ripe plums and black cherry cola. The mid-palate has some nice umami notes, sautéed mushrooms and a hint of roasted tomatoes but the finish is more like a cherry pit and plum skins, a little thin and bitter, which is less than ideal for me. Hard to tell what the story here is. Maybe I’ll wait a while on my next bottle in hopes that it’s just in a weird spot now but I’m not holding my breath.

    October 9, 2016 - So the first 1/2 bottle I drank over an hour after about 30 mins of air....tart, out of balance tar mixed with stewed cherries and beef bullion. Refrigerated other half for 24 hours in a vacuum pumped 375 ml bottle. Let the 2nd half breathe for an hour...nose of cherries and spice...color darker and deeper....dusty Lingrin cherries followed by raspberries....dust, tea, spice....nice tart acids now in check. I think this could have aged 10 more years!
